| DANIEL, James, a resident of Tallassee, died Thursday, Feb. 28, 2000. The funeral was Friday, March 3, from McKenzie's Funeral Home Chapel with Rev. John Andrews officiating. Burial was in Sweet Canaan Cemetery. McKenzie's Funeral Home staff directed. His survivors include two daughters, Carol (Eddie, Sr.) Thomas, Shorter and Pamela Daniel, Tallassee; one sister, Gloria (Willie) Johnson, Tallassee, three brothers; Joseph (Virginia) Daniel, Tuskegee; Robert (Geraldine) Daniel, Tallassee, and Lester Hicks, Jr. Cleveland, OH; five grandchildren and a host of other loving relatives and friends. The Tuskegee News, August 10, 2000, Page A-5 DAVIS, Howard Dr., former
Tuskegee University athletic director, died Thursday, May 20, 1999 in Greene County, AL.
The funeral for Dr. Davis was held Thursday, May 27 from Cascade United Methodist Church
in Atlanta, GA with interment in Forest Lawn Memorial Gardens, C College Park, GA. Rev.
Douglas Childers and Rev. Cynthia Harris officiated. Dr. Davis was born May 5, 1930 in
Westville, SC. He attended Mather Academy from where he graduated in 1950. He later
graduated from Allen University in Columbia, SC with a major in health, physical education
and recreation, and a minor in general science. He was married to the devoted
Eunice Ware Davis. In addition to his loving wife, Dr. Davis also leaves to cherish his
memory: sons, Toddy (Misty) Davis, MD, Chicago, IL; Scott Davis, Jackson, MS; daughters,
Mrs. Carolyn (DePriest) Waddy, Marietta, GA; Kiah (Edward) Mitchell, MD, Fayetteville, GA;
Ms. Shawn Davis, St. Louis, MO; Mrs. Ericka (LaTroy) Thomas, Des Moines, Iowa; Cheryl
(Marcus) Wharry, PhD, Columbus, GA; a brother, Jason (Tina) Davis, Raleigh, NC; sisters,
Mrs. Carolyn Payne, Twin Oaks, PA; and Mrs. Helen (Neil) Moore, Detroit, MI; loving aunts,
Mrs. Stella Paulin and Mrs. Easter Harris, Washington, DC; five grandchildren, and a host
of nieces, nephews, cousins and friends. The Tuskegee News, June 22, 2000
